Education: BA, Chemistry and Biology, Minot State University, 1985 PhD, Biochemistry, North Dakota State University, 1989 Postdoctoral Research Fellowship, University of Virginia, 1989-1990 Postdoctoral Research Associate, South Dakota State University, 1990-1992
Specialty/Certification: Mammalian Biochemistry and Physiology
Professional Emphasis: Teaching Emphasis: Physiology of Livestock, Glycobiology Research Emphasis: Microbial Adherence, Genetic Resistance to Infectious Disease, Protective Role of the Glycocalyx on Enterocytes.
Recent Professional News: Currently developing a graduate course in Glycobiology. Recently received funding from USDA-NRI CGP to study biochemical mechanisms of genetic resistance to K88 E. coli infections, and from NIH-AREA program to study the role of the apical glycocalyx in protecting enterocytes.
